Moroccan Proptech Agenz Secures $5 Million to Revolutionize Real Estate Transactions

Morocco’s Digital Property Future Brightens as Agenz Raises $5 Million

Morocco’s real estate sector is poised for a significant digital transformation following Agenz’s successful fundraising round. The proptech startup, which specializes in digitizing property transactions, has secured $5 million from investors including Breega, Attijariwafa Ventures, and Saviu Ventures.

The investment comes as Morocco’s residential land market shows strong growth, with over 140,000 transactions recorded in 2023 – a notable increase from the previous year. This expansion presents significant opportunities for digital platforms that streamline property processes.

“We envision a future where real estate is built on responsible data usage and AI,” stated Malik Belkeziz, Co-founder and CEO of Agenz. “Our goal is to create a more transparent, secure, and accessible market while prioritizing user trust.” The funding will accelerate this vision by expanding services for individuals, agents, developers, investors, and financial institutions.

Integrated Platform Drives Efficiency

Agenz offers an all-in-one solution that combines property valuation tools, market intelligence, professional services solutions, and digital transaction capabilities. Since launching its transaction platform in 2023, the company has seen substantial growth in user activity, including surpassing 730,000 monthly visits to its website in May 2024.

Driss Ibenmansour of Breega noted that Agenz “has built the missing platform for Morocco’s real estate sector,” bringing together data, tools, and transactions into a single experience. This comprehensive approach positions Agenz as a key driver of market modernization.
